Steel bars are manufactured in the rolling process, whereby they are characterized by strain hardening and poor plastic properties. In many application cases such properties are improper, therefore, additional heat treatment is required. Crucial influence on the products quality after heat treatment has an appropriate selection of process parameters. In many modern technologies of heat treatment the charge of porous structure is subjected to the heating process. Proper control of heat treatment parameters of bundles of rods requires knowledge on their thermal properties. However, it also requires accurate identification of complex heat transfer processes occurring in the porous material. Such analysis, with respect to bundles of bars, provide a response of qualitative nature of the heat exchange area of these charges. The article describes the emissivity measurements of samples of the steel charge using a thermal imaging camera.
